Belleville Police are looking to identify a suspect in the theft of multiple credit cards from a vehicle parked at Zwick’s Park.On April 10, at around 5 p.m., police received a report of a theft of multiple credit cards from a vehicle. Police say following the theft, the credit cards were used at multiple businesses accumulating upwards of $10,000 in transactions.Anyone with information about the identity of the suspect is asked to contact Belleville Police or Crime Stoppers.
